**CI note: flaky export retries on the Fernwick pipeline**

Hey reviewer — the nightly export to the Opaline warehouse keeps failing on transient timeouts, so I added exponential backoff with three retries and a jitter cap of 30s. If all retries fail, the job now exits nonzero instead of silently passing. Repro details are attached; the failing run's token is below.

session token of tajef-bageg = htk21_5d90d574934f3ccae6437

CI note for support: snapshot tests for Lanternkit UI components fail intermittently on the shared runners. Cause is font rasterization differences between runner images, not product bugs. Workaround: customers reporting "snapshot mismatch" in their pipelines should pin the runner image version and regenerate baselines once. Do not advise deleting snapshots wholesale. The fix to normalize rasterization settings is in review. When escalating, include the failing job's build token, shown below for reference.

pipeline stamp: htk21_86b657ac0aa916a9af17f

Q3 Planning Note — Logistics Transition

For the incoming director. Effective next quarter we drop Corvalis Freight and move all outbound volume to Bramwell Logistics. Reasons: two missed peak-season windows, a 9% rate hike, and poor cold-chain performance on the Estover route. Bramwell contract is signed; transition plan owned by operations, eight-week cutover. Expect short-term disruption at the Kelderton depot. Costs net out roughly flat in year one, favorable after. Strategic context is in the confidential note that follows below.

confidential, bahap-bajog: Zorethix Works is in early talks to buy Kelethox Foods for about $30.7 million. The Ralvan launch date is September 19, and nothing goes to the press before then.

Handover note for support: snapshot tests for the Lanternbox UI component library now run on every merge. A failed snapshot usually means an intentional visual change that wasn't re-approved, not a genuine bug — check the diff image attached to the pipeline before filing anything. Approvals happen through the review-snapshots command documented in the team wiki. If a customer reports a visual regression that slipped through, escalate to the engineer named below.

account owner for bawip-tahag: Raleth Quenok